Modern reel layout had actually started in England during the latter component of the 18th century, and the primary design in operation was called the 'Nottingham reel'. The reel was a vast drum that spooled out openly and was suitable for enabling the bait to wander a long method out with the current.


The product made use of for the rod itself changed from the heavy woods belonging to England to lighter and a lot more elastic selections imported from abroad, particularly from South America and the West Indies (Chehalis River fishing Guide). Bamboo poles ended up being the generally favoured alternative from the mid 19th century, and a number of strips of the product were cut from the walking cane, grated right into shape, and after that glued together to create the light, strong, hexagonal poles with a solid core that were exceptional to anything that preceded them


Angling ended up being a popular leisure task in the 19th century. Print from Currier and Ives. Tackle layout began to boost from the 1880s. The introduction of brand-new timbers to the manufacture of fly rods made it feasible to cast flies into the wind on silk lines, as opposed to steed hair.

These early fly lines showed bothersome as they had actually to be covered with different dressings to make them drift and required to be taken off the reel and dried every four hours or so to avoid them from ending up being waterlogged. One more unfavorable repercussion was that it ended up being very easy for the much longer line to get into a tangle this was called a 'tangle' in Britain, and a 'backlash' in the US.

The American, Charles F. Orvis, made and distributed an unique reel and fly design in 1874, explained by reel chronicler Jim Brown as the "benchmark of American reel style," and the initial fully contemporary fly reel. Albert Illingworth, 1st Baron Illingworth a fabrics magnate, patented the contemporary kind of fixed-spool spinning reel in 1905.


Since the line did not need to pull navigate to these guys against a turning spindle, much lighter lures might be cast than with standard reels. The growth of economical fiberglass poles, artificial fly lines, and monofilament leaders in the early 1950s restored the appeal of fly angling. Why a fish bites a baited hook or appeal includes several variables associated to the sensory physiology, behaviour, feeding ecology, and biology of the fish along with the atmosphere and characteristics of the bait/hook/lure. There is a detailed link in between different angling methods and knowledge regarding the fish and their behaviour consisting of migration, foraging and environment.




Some fishers adhere to fishing folklores which assert that fish feeding patterns are influenced by the placement of the sun and the moon. An angler on the Kennet and Avon Canal, England, with his take on Fishing deals with are the tools utilized by fishers when angling. Almost any type of tools or gear utilized for angling can be called an angling deal with, although the term is most generally related to gear utilized in fishing.


Fishing methods describe the means the tackles are utilized when angling. Tackles that are connected to the end of a fishing line are collectively called terminal deals with. These consist of hooks, weights, floats, leader lines, swivels, split rings, and any type of cords, breaks, grains, spoons, blades, rewriters and clevises made use of to affix spinner blades to fishing attractions.
